Orlando Contractor Comparison Points

Use these checks when comparing exterminators serving Orlando. They are designed to make each estimate more specific, easier to verify, and less dependent on generic averages.

  • Verify that termite inspections and wood-destroying insect reports are priced separately.
  • Request the product label or treatment category when allergies, children, or pets are a concern.
  • Separate general pest service from termite, bed bug, mosquito, and wildlife work.
  • Ask which pests are included in the treatment plan and which require separate pricing.
  • Ask for the estimate, warranty, exclusions, and scheduling assumptions in writing.

For pest control, that means the pest control quote should explain the target pests, treatment zones, follow-up policy, product category, and conditions the homeowner must correct.

Estimate itemWhy it mattersQuestion to ask
Pest categoryGeneral insects, termites, bed bugs, mosquitoes, and wildlife are usually scoped and priced separately.Which pests are covered by this visit and which need a separate quote?
Interior accessPets, children, allergies, and tenant access can change preparation and timing.What prep steps, product category, and re-entry window apply?
Follow-up policyA cheap first visit can be poor value if retreatment or monitoring is excluded.How many visits are included, and what triggers a no-charge callback?
Exterior conditionsMoisture, mulch, vegetation, gaps, and entry points affect whether treatment holds.Which exterior conditions should the homeowner correct before or after service?

What happens if pests return after treatment in Orlando?

Reputable Orlando pest control companies include re-treatment guarantees. If pests return within the warranty period, they'll return at no extra cost. Most warranties cover 30-90 days after treatment. Always get warranty terms in writing.

Should I leave during pest control treatment in Orlando?

For standard treatments in Orlando, you typically don't need to leave. For fumigation or severe infestations, you may need to vacate for 24-72 hours. Your Kentucky technician will advise based on the specific treatment.
